国际足球比赛结果数据集指南
international_results 项目地址: https://gitcode.com/gh_mirrors/in/international_results
本指南将带您详细了解位于 https://github.com/martj42/international_results.git 的开源项目。该项目提供了一个详尽的国际男子足球比赛记录数据库,从1872年至2024年的比赛数据。下面我们将按照指定内容模块逐一进行介绍。
1. 项目目录结构及介绍
项目采用简洁的目录布局,便于用户快速查找所需数据。以下是主要的目录结构:
international_results/
├── LICENSE # 许可证文件,遵循CC0-1.0许可协议
├── README.md # 项目概述和数据集说明文档
├── goalscorers.csv # 进球者信息表,包括进球日期、队伍、球员等
├── results.csv # 比赛结果主数据表,含比赛日期、主客队、比分等
├── shootouts.csv # 点球大战记录表,包含点球日期、队伍及胜者等信息
└── discussions # 可能包含项目讨论或附加文档(未在示例中明确给出)
- results.csv 是核心文件,包含了比赛的详细结果。
- goalscorers.csv 提供了每场比赛的进球者详情。
- shootouts.csv 记录了通过点球决出胜负的比赛情况。
- LICENSE 和 README.md 分别提供了版权信息和项目说明。
2. 项目的启动文件介绍
此项目不是一个运行型的应用程序,因此没有传统意义上的“启动文件”。其核心在于数据的利用而非执行代码。不过,要“启动”对这个数据集的分析或使用,您可以从下载 results.csv, goalscorers.csv, 和 shootouts.csv 文件开始,随后可以在数据分析软件如Python pandas库中导入这些CSV文件来开始您的分析之旅。
例如,在Python环境下,一个简单的“启动”示例可能涉及以下步骤:
import pandas as pd
# 加载数据
results = pd.read_csv('results.csv')
goalscorers = pd.read_csv('goalscorers.csv')
shootouts = pd.read_csv('shootouts.csv')
3. 项目的配置文件介绍
项目本身不包含传统的配置文件,因为数据集是以静态CSV文件形式提供的,无需特定的运行时配置。对于分析或应用这些数据到自己的项目中,您可能需要自己创建配置文件来管理数据库连接、分析参数或是脚本设置等,但这不是原项目的一部分。
如果您打算基于此数据集开发应用程序或进行复杂的数据处理工作,推荐的做法是根据个人需求定制配置文件,例如.env
用于存储API密钥或数据库连接字符串,或者使用YAML文件来定义分析流程的参数。
总结来说,该开源项目重在提供数据而非应用框架,因此重点在于如何导入和利用这些数据文件,而不是有特定的启动或配置文件。希望以上介绍能帮助您有效地开始您的数据探索之旅。
international_results 项目地址: https://gitcode.com/gh_mirrors/in/international_results